Manning Personnel Group, Inc., is working with a Biotechnology Research firm in Boston as they are actively seeking an Employee and Office Experience Coordinator.
The Employee and Office Experience Coordinator will be responsible for planning and executing events, supporting day-to-day office operations, and partnering with Human Resources.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
Maintain a welcoming, organized, and efficient office environment, including ordering office supplies, greeting visitors, handling kitchen/food services, and vendor relationships.
Provide administrative support to HR, updating organizational charts, and maintaining our company intranet site.
Serve as a visible and enthusiastic ambassador for office culture, reinforcing values across all employee touchpoints.
Lead event planning committee and ensure consistent communications.
Plan, coordinate, and execute company events, celebrations, team-building activities, and social gatherings.
Identify and propose new initiatives that strengthen team connection, engagement, and community.
Assist with special projects and cross-functional initiatives as needed.
QUALIFICATIONS:
Bachelor’s degree and 2-4 years of prior experience in office administration, employee experience, HR coordination or operations
Experience in start-up environment and biotech/life sciences industry is a plus
Strong communication and interpersonal skills, comfortable collaborating with employees at all levels
Attention to detail and strong organization sk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ks and prioritize effectively
